Sherry Ann Rhodes, 65, of Deep River, passed away on Sunday, April 12, 2021 at Middlesex Hospital in Middletown, Connecticut. Born January 2, 1956 in Shelby North Carolina; she was the daughter of the late Howard and Ruth (Ward) Sisk. Sherry was a 1974 graduate of Shelby High School. She married her husband Ronald Edwin Rhodes on November 8, 1998, the couple shared 13 years of marriage together until he predeceased her in 2011. Sherry will always be remembered as a loving woman who was a mother to all. When her son Thomas was growing up she would volunteer her time at the school as an assistant in the classroom teaching them how to read. She was always a fixture at the swim team meets. In the early 90’s, she ran a restaurant called Bojangles. For over 10 years she worked as a dispatcher for OnStar, until she moved to Connecticut in 2012 and then became a dispatcher for Companions and Homemakers where she continued to care for others in need. In her spare time she enjoyed crafting, particularly crocheting. She is survived by her son Thomas and wife Sherri Sisk of Colchester, CT grandchildren Joseph Staley-Sisk, Emily Farrington, and Mikayla Farrington, all of Colchester; sisters-in-law Sheila Sisk of Shelby, NC, and Sylvia Rhodes of Charlottesville, NC; and numerous other extended family and friends. In addition to her parents she is predeceased by her nine siblings. Care of private arrangements have been entrusted to the Aurora-McCarthy Funeral Home.
